In rural areas, women remain the backbone of agricultural communities, handling both farming duties and household chores. In cities, the rise of support systems like daycare centers, professional domestic help, and meal-delivery services has allowed women to pursue full-time corporate careers, entrepreneurship, and public service. Career, Education, and Economic Independence

Despite high educational aspirations, a "traditional economic role" preference persists; 80% of Indians believe men should get hiring preference when jobs are scarce.
